No. 17-168
 
Title: Robin Antonick, Petitioner
v.
Electronic Arts, Inc.
Docketed: August 2, 2017
Linked with: 16A1197
Lower Ct: United States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it
   Case Numbers: (14-15298)
   Decision Date: November 22, 2016
   Rehearing Denied: March 16, 2017
 
Proceedings and Orders
Jun 01 2017 Application (16A1197) to extend the time to file a petition for a writ of certiorari from June 14, 2017 to July 14, 2017, submitted to Justice Kennedy.
Jun 07 2017 Application (16A1197) granted by Justice Kennedy extending the time to file until July 14, 2017.
Jul 10 2017 Application (16A1197) to extend further the time from July 14, 2017 to July 28, 2017, submitted to Justice Kennedy.
Jul 14 2017 Application (16A1197) granted by Justice Kennedy extending the time to file until July 28, 2017.
Jul 28 2017 Petition for a writ of certiorari filed. (Response due September 1, 2017)
Aug 22 2017 Order extending time to file response to petition to and including October 2, 2017.
Sep 01 2017 Brief amici curiae of Intellectual Property Law Professors filed.
Sep 28 2017 Brief of respondent Electronic Arts Inc. in opposition filed.
Oct 11 2017 Reply of petitioner Robert Antonick filed.
Oct 18 2017 DISTRIBUTED for Conference of 11/3/2017.
Nov 06 2017 Petition DENIED. Justice Breyer took no part in the consideration or decision of this petition.
